I started with a 4 1/4″ x 11″ piece of Basic Beige cardstock that I scored and folded on the long side at 2 3/4″ and 5 1/2″.  Then I folded the 2 3/4″ score line as a mountain and the 5 1/2″ as a valley to make the Z-fold.

I matted a piece of strawberry-strewn paper from the Storybook Moments Specialty DSP on a Cherry Cobbler mat and then adhered it to the small front panel of the z-fold with Liquid Glue.

For the back (inside) panel, I adhered a second piece of strawberry-strewn Storybook Moments Specialty DSP to the right side of a Cherry Cobbler mat using Liquid Glue.

I used Liquid Glue to adhere a die cut strawberry bundle (from the die cut sheets in the Storybook Moments Specialty DSP) on a Basic White panel.

I adhered the panel on the other side of the Cherry Cobbler mat and then onto the back (inside) panel of the card base.

For the front panel, I stamped the Storybook Friends sentiment in Cherry Cobbler on a Basic Beige panel.

I put one of the Linked Together Decorative Masks in place and used Small Blending Brushes to add Boho Blue ink (lightly!!) to the top part of the panel and Basic Beige on the lower half.

Using Liquid Glue, I adhered the panel to a Cherry Cobbler mat.

I selected some die cut images from one of the two sheets of die cuts in the Storybook Moments Specialty DSP.  Using Liquid Glue, I adhered the nicely-dressed tall ewe, the cattail die cut and the white picket fence.

Then I added a flower die cut (in front of the ewe) and a grasses image (on the right) with more Liquid Glue.

I added the final bush and the sweet duck with Stampin’ Dimensionals.

Using Liquid Glue on the left side of the panel, I adhered it to the front panel of the z-fold.

I added a few Antique Pearls and the card was done!

Card Cuts Used in the This Project:

Basic Beige Cardstock: 4 1/4″ x 11″ (large card base, scored & folded at 2 3/4″ and 5 1/2″); 2 7/8″ x 3 7/8″ (front panel)

Cherry Cobbler Cardstock: 2 5/8″ x 4 1/8″ (mat for front z-fold DSP panel); 3″ x 4″ (mat for front panel); 4 1/8″ x 5 3/8″ (mat for inside panel)

Basic White Cardstock: 2 3/8″ x 4″ (inside panel left side)

Storybook Moments DSP: 2 1/2″ x 4″ (front z-fold DSP panel); 2 3/4″ x 4″ (inside panel right side); Die cut elements on front panel;  2 1/4″ x 6″ (envelope flap)
